Key Responsibilities:

  • Accompany clients to specialist medical appointments, providing verbal and written interpretation services as needed.
  • Stay with clients throughout their appointments and attend follow-up sessions when required.
  • Relay all relevant information regarding the patient's case back to the Medical Department.
  • Communicate any necessary follow-up appointments.
  • Always maintain strict confidentiality.
  • Perform any tasks or responsibilities as requested by management within the scope of the position.

Knowledge and Skills:

  • Fluent in traditional Arabic and English, both written and verbal.
  • Experience as a Medical Interpreter, with a demonstrated history in a similar role.
  • Degree or qualification in Interpreting Services (desirable).
  • Proficiency in MS Office and database management.

How to prepare for a job interview at UK Mission Enterprise Limited

Know Your Medical Terminology

Brush up on medical terminology in both Arabic and English. Being fluent isn't just about language; it's also about understanding the context. Familiarity with common medical terms will help you interpret accurately and confidently during the interview.

Showcase Your Experience

Prepare specific examples from your past roles as a Medical Interpreter. Think of situations where you successfully navigated complex interpretations or handled sensitive information. This will demonstrate your capability and experience to the interviewers.

Practice Active Listening

During the interview, practice active listening. This means fully concentrating on what the interviewer is saying, which will help you respond thoughtfully. It’s a key skill for a Medical Interpreter, so showing it off in your interview can really set you apart.

Emphasise Confidentiality

Be ready to discuss how you handle confidentiality in your work. Share examples of how you've maintained patient privacy in previous roles. This is crucial in the medical field, and demonstrating your commitment to confidentiality will resonate well with the interviewers.
